2004 Chevrolet Silverado 1500 5.3L Misfire, MIL Lamp on
We have a problem child we can't seem to figure out. came in with random miss fire and B2S1 low activity and no activity. observed pids and found #3 & #4 having miss fire pids, also B2S1 seemed flat line, found #3 injector un plugged, re connected injector...
